>> I made a symlink farm to krb5 sources and ran configure.

My usual procedure is to make a symlink farm, run util/reconf in that,
and then move to *another* directory for the build, and use configure
with the --srcdir option (although running configure with an absolute
or relative path should do the right thing as well.) This does mean
that you need sunmake or gnumake.
